The City of Good Living: Suburban Charm with Silicon Valley Access
Located in the heart of the San Francisco Peninsula, San Carlos lives up to its nickname as the “City of Good Living.” With a welcoming, small-town feel and close proximity to both San Francisco and Silicon Valley, San Carlos offers one of the most balanced lifestyles in San Mateo County. Residents enjoy a blend of historic neighborhoods, modern amenities, and a thriving downtown scene that draws both locals and visitors.
San Carlos real estate includes charming bungalows, updated mid-century homes, luxury hillside properties, and new condo developments—all within minutes of top schools, Caltrain, parks, and downtown attractions. Popular neighborhoods include White Oaks, Brittan Acres, and the scenic hills west of Alameda.
At the heart of town is Laurel Street, lined with local boutiques, gourmet restaurants, wine bars, and community favorites. From family-friendly events like the Art & Wine Faire to live music and farmers markets, San Carlos offers a strong sense of community and connection.
With highly rated schools, access to tech corridors, and walkable living, San Carlos real estate continues to attract buyers looking for both quality of life and long-term value on the Peninsula.
30,696 people live in San Carlos, where the median age is 41.6 and the average individual income is $126,162. Data provided by the U.S. Census Bureau.
